Ross Mirkarimi misses his son

The restraining order that has separated Sheriff Ross Mirkarimi from his two-year-old son, Theo, may be amended on Wednesday. This modification would allow the two to reunite for the first time since January 13, when Mirkarimi was arrested on three misdemeanor charges of "domestic violence battery [of his wife], child endangerment, and dissuading a witness," to which Mirkarimi pleaded not guilty.

Eliana Lopez, his wife, has told reporters how much Theo misses his father. The boy has implored Lopez as to when his dad will come home; he runs upstairs to the window every evening, expecting Ross to return; he has spent hours crying and wondering where his father is. Mirkarimi recently bought Theo two news books to read until the restraining order is modified.
